Fidelity National Financial reported second quarter results with net earnings attributable to common shareholders of $219 million, or $0.81 per diluted share, compared to $537 million, or $1.92 per share, for the second quarter of 2022. Adjusted net earnings attributable to common shareholders for the second quarter were $274 million, or $1.01 per share, compared to $557 million, or $2.00 per share, for the second quarter of 2022.
Title Segment total revenue was $1.9 billion, a 27% decrease from the second quarter of 2022.
F&G Segment gross sales were $3.0 billion, a 3% decrease from the second quarter of 2022.
F&G Segment assets under management (AUM) reached a record $46.3 billion as of June 30, 2023.
FNF paid common dividends of $0.45 per share for $121 million in the second quarter.
The company focuses on balance sheet strength and remains committed to its quarterly cash dividend while prudently moderating share repurchase activity.
